Under the direction of the Manager of Revenue Cycle Management, the Complex Medical Claims Project Specialist (AR manager) is responsible for the consolidation of tasks between the AVP of RCM, the Manager of Revenue Optimization and the Manager of Revenue Cycle Management. This position will be responsible for research for complex Revenue Cycle projects and working on specialized projects given by the leadership team.
Primary Job Duties:
Runs, reviews and analyzes RCM reports and communicates denial sources and revenue cycle trends.
Works closely with our Revenue Optimization team, to support efforts to ensure reimbursement is in line with payer contract agreements. Performs Denial analysis utilizing the Trizetto platform
Drive toward achievement of department’s daily and monthly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), requiring a team focused approach to attainment of these goals
Responsible for auditing all RCM Management Reports to ensure accuracy and to identity areas of opportunity for improvement
Ability to effectively communicate and escalate RCM issues and areas of concern.
Other duties as assigned
Education: High School diploma
Experience: 5+ years medical claims experience in a physician medical billing office
Must understand the drivers of revenue cycle optimal performance and be able to investigate and resolve complex claims.
Must understand Explanation of Benefit (EOB) statements
Advanced Microsoft Excel skills

The salary range for this role is $50,000 to $60,000 in base pay. This role is also eligible for an annual bonus targeted at 15% based on performance in the role. The base pay offered will be determined based on relevant factors such as experience, education, and geographic location.
